description |
This thesis focuses on proposing a new XML conceptual modeling technique by exploring the possibility of extending ER model. The proposed model will include requirements such as friendly graphical notation, specify cardinality for all relationships and characteristic special for XML such as ordering, mixed content, construct for irregular structure and so on. We validated our proposed model through two case studies. Finally, a framework is developed to test the up and down translation from conceptual modelling to schema code generation and vice-versa. |
